How make a claim on the SimplyGo app for ABT transaction?

After you have logged in to the apps, look for the trip that you want to make a claim. The amount must be in "green" box (instead of "grey" box). If the amount is in a green box, you can click on it, and there is a claim button for you to submit your claim.

For those trips where the amount is in grey box, wait for 2-3 days and it should turn into green box.

I have a missing entry since 7-July, until now still gray
Mastercard is accumulated for more days before being charged. You have to wait till the transaction is charged to your Mastercard. You can make a claim thereafter and the amount will be credited back separately to your Mastercard as another transaction.
